How the Concept of a Defending Champion Actually Works
At its core, Understanding the Concept of a Defending Champion in the Market refers to identifying an entity or approach that demonstrates resilience and the ability to maintain its position during challenging periods. A defender is characterized by its capacity to withstand pressures that cause others to falter, not necessarily by being the absolute highest performer in a bull market. The focus is on consistency, strong fundamentals, and a solid foundation.
Consider a hypothetical market segment where multiple companies are offering similar services. When economic uncertainty rises, consumer spending tightens, and competition intensifies, one company may continue to retain its customer base and maintain steady operations. This company would exemplify Understanding the Concept of a Defending Champion in the Market. It might do so through a combination of factors: a loyal customer base with recurring needs, a balance sheet with low debt, efficient cost management, and a clear ability to adapt its core offering to remain essential. Its "defense" comes from these structural strengths that provide a buffer against external shocks.

What specific traits define a market defender? A true defender typically exhibits a combination of characteristics. These often include a durable business model that provides a necessary product or service, a history of consistent performance across multiple cycles, a strong balance sheet with manageable debt levels, and a competitive advantage that is difficult to replicate. The focus is less on rapid expansion and more on sustainable operations.
Is a defending champion the same as a low-risk investment? While defenders are often associated with lower volatility, Understanding the Concept of a Defending Champion in the Market does not equate to a guarantee against all risk. All investments carry some level of uncertainty. A defender is best understood as a relative concept within a specific market context, showing greater resilience compared to peers during a downturn, rather than being immune to market forces.
Can the status of a defending champion change over time? Absolutely. Market dynamics, consumer preferences, and regulatory landscapes evolve. What demonstrates defending champion status today may not necessarily hold that position tomorrow if the underlying conditions shift. Continuous assessment of the factors that provide resilience is an ongoing part of the analysis.

Common Misunderstandings to Correct
Several misconceptions can distort the true nature of this market concept and hinder a clear understanding. One frequent error is confusing a defender with a stagnant or overly conservative choice. In reality, a strong defender often innovates and evolves to maintain its relevance. Its resilience comes from active adaptation and strengthening its core, not from standing still.
Another misunderstanding is the belief that a defender will always outperform in every type of market environment. While the goal is to hold position during a downturn, this focus on stability might mean that the growth rate is more modest during a rapid upswing compared to more aggressive participants. Understanding this trade-off is key to integrating the concept into a balanced view.
